Open APIs

TMF654 - Bucket POST API - UsageType not sufficient for the Operation

  • 1.  TMF654 - Bucket POST API - UsageType not sufficient for the Operation

    TM Forum Member
    Posted Mar 10, 2021 06:34
    Edited by Karan Agrawal Mar 10, 2021 06:36
    Hello Experts,
    As per TMF-654 User Guide / Conformance Profile v4, usageType is the ONLY Mandatory field.
    But, with just knowing the type of resource, it cannot be deduced if the bucket is for USD / EURO / Free Minutes / Free Seconds / etc.

    A] amount | remainingValue, of type Quantity, must be mandatory and Quantity should default amount to 0 units instead of 1 unit
    B] It is lacking the target product/partyAccount - who owns this bucket!? At least one of them should be mandatory
    C] What should be the behavior if an attempt is made to create bucket for same product with same validity (amount/remainingValue may or may not be same)?


    ------------------------------
    Karan Agrawal
    Oracle Corporation
    ------------------------------